Since the Oppo Find N2 Flip entered the battle, the folding phone market has been more competitiv. It is prompting competitors to raise their game. According to leaks, Samsung and Motorola will therefore include larger outside screens on their future foldables.
The Galaxy Z Flip 5 has been the subject of many rumours. But a recent photograph posted by reputable tipster Ice Universe offers the first look at the new cover screen for the foldable phone. The device’s unusual folder-shaped cover screen is displayed in the picture, along with other design elements.
Previous rumours claim that the Z Flip 5’s cover screen would measure somewhere between 3.3 and 3.4 inches. Which is a big increase over the Z Flip4’s 1.9-inch panel. The odd folder-shaped notch at the bottom that houses the two cameras is one distinguishing feature.
The informant adds that these photos show the finished product. Furthermore Samsung is now tweaking its software to make the most of the bigger screen. It is quite likely that the larger outside screen will be well-optimized for the onboard software because Samsung already has an advantage over its rivals when it comes to the software implementation for folding phones.
According to recent sources, Samsung intends to introduce the Galaxy Tab S9 series and the Z Flip 5 and Z Fold 5 together in late July. Oppo and Motorola are also anticipated to introduce their competing products later this year.
